SSI throws Fares Barakat from the 4th floor when he asks for search warrant

Hospital permits handcuffs on Barakat while in ICU

Damanhour public attorney rejects referral of Barakat to equipped hospital

On the 17th of May 2009 at 7 p.m. a state security police force in Damanhour, led by SSI officer Nagi El Gammal broke into the apartment of Ahmed Ali Hussein Eid in Damanhour – Beheira governorate while the latter was celebrating the 7th day of birth of his daughter Menna Ahmed Eid in the presence of a number of family members and friends. The police force broke into the apartment, aggressed the family and their friends and arrested them claiming to have a warrant. The search and arrest were violent and abusive.

According to witnesses and the minutes of case no. 4916/2009/administrative/Damanhour, when officers Nagi El Gammal and assistant Gamal el Taye’e were carrying out the arrest, Fares Barakat, one of the friends present, asked to see the prosecutor’s warrant for search and arrest, upon which he was pushed back by Nagi el Gammal towards the balcony. When he tried to resist he was held back by Gamal el Taye’e who was ordered by El Gammal: “To throw this man from the balcony”. Barakat fell from the 4th floor, was badly injured and lost consciousness.

Bystanders called the ambulance which transferred Barakat, accompanied by his brother and wife, to the national medical institute in Damanhour. At the hospital he was admitted into ICU on the second floor at 8 p.m. where he was examined and x-rayed. Investigations revealed that Barakat was suffering the following:

 

Fracture of the right leg, hip and shoulder, three pelvic fractures, fracture nose, facial injuries, fracture of three vertebrae, blood accumulation in the stomach and around the liver, post concussion syndrome and difficulty breathing to upward pressure of abdominal blood collections.

On the 19th of May 2009 Barakat’s lawyers submitted a request to the public attorney in Beheira requesting an investigation in the violence by Nagi El Gammal and Gamal El Taye’e against Barakat. However the public attorney Magdi El Ghannam himself signed a rejection of the request, claiming that the investigation lies within the judicial authority of Damanhour. Later on the same day Barakat’s family submitted a similar request to the public attorney, which was equally rejected.

Once again: medicine in service of SSI

At 5.30 at the National Medical Institute in Damanhour chief intelligence officers Mohamed Ammar and Abdel Aziz El Tanikhi accompanied by a police force circled the ICU, preventing doctors and family from entering claiming that the prosecution has ordered the detention of Barakat. Ammar then insisted to question Barakat and when the family protested they were threatened to be forcefully thrown out of the hospital. An hour and a half later Ammar left the ICU carrying several sheets of paper signed by Barakat depicting a different story from what had happened. Again the lawyers filed a complaint against Ammar for breaking into the ICU and questioning Barakat in his deteriorating condition.

Since the detention of Barakat his lawyers have submitted several requests to have him to transferred to a private hospital since the one he is in lacks the necessary medical facilities. Specifically they requested that he be transferred to Mostafa Kamel hospital in Alexandria to operate on internal fixation of his pelvic fractures. Again the public attorney of Beheira rejected their request and insisted to summon forensic medicine to confirm his need for such procedure. In the meantime Barakat’s condition is worsening and he continues to be kept in ICU under strict police surveillance and handcuffed to his bed for fear he might escape!!

Two independent members of parliament have submitted a demand for urgent questioning of the minister of interior in both the Defense and National Security and the Human Rights committees in parliament.
